Installation of an exhaust system always requires
a permit.
Exhaust Connection
The unit is to be connected to suitable exhaust systems
whose design has been approved.
G
Make sure to maintain a safe distance to flamma-
ble materials!
Exhaust systems are structural systems located either
in or on buildings whose sole purpose is to expel ex-
haust from heating appliances safely above the roof.
When planning for the exhaust system, please observe
the following:
à The exhaust system must be installed and assem-
bled properly and in accordance with the relevant
regulations.
à The dimensions of the exhaust lines must be ad-
justed to the capacity of the unit and the construction
height.
à The dimensions of the exhaust systems must ensure
that the exhaust is expelled to the outside regardless
of the operating conditions and guarantee that no
positive pressure is produced in the rooms. These
dimensions are based on the cross-section and
height, and to the extent required, the heat penetra-
bility resistance and internal surface.
à The exhaust system openings must stick out at least
40 cm beyond the top of the roof or be at least 1 m
away from the surface of the roof.
à If impact pressures, e.g. from fall winds or neigh-
bouring buildings, are anticipated, the top of the
chimney should be shaped accordingly.
à The exhaust system must be attached securely and
properly according to the manufacturer’s specifica-
tions.
à In roof structures, the exhaust system must be led
through a pipe casing or a chute to allow the exhaust
line to expand when heated.
à The unit connection must be impermeable and se-
cured with rivets or screws from becoming acciden-
tally loose.
à It is preferable to have a horizontal exhaust line that
is as short as possible.
Incline 2 % = 2 cm/m.
à You should plan to have a closable opening for per-
forming measurements at a distance of 2 x
∅
ex-
haust pipe behind the unit connection.
Under certain circumstances, it is possible to meas-
ure the exhaust opening.
à The double-walled, REMKO stainless steel exhaust
systems have been approved by the Institut für
Bautechnik (German Institute for Construction Engi-
neering) in accordance with DIN 18160 Part 1.
